About The Position

POSITION TITLE: Victim Witness Assistant LOCATION: District Attorney’s Office, Cleveland County Courthouse STATUS: Part-time SALARY: $14.00 per hour KEY RESPONSIBILITIES: The purpose of this position is to provide direct support to victims of crime through each stage of the Juvenile Justice System. Victim Witness Assistants act as a liaison between the Assistant District Attorney and the victims involved in the criminal case prosecuted by the District Attorney. This position is required to maintain and document direct contact with victims/witnesses and keep them informed of their rights and the status of their case while also offering ongoing emotional support. The employee will assess the needs of victims and offer referrals for resources when appropriate.
